Space-Saving Furniture Ideas

We love using multifunctional furniture to maximize space in barn conversions. When it comes to space-saving furniture ideas, here are three compact living solutions that provide hidden storage techniques:

  1. The convertible sleeper sofa: This versatile piece of furniture serves as a comfortable seating area during the day and can be effortlessly transformed into a cozy bed at night. It also features hidden storage compartments, perfect for storing extra bedding or pillows.

  2. Wall-mounted foldable dining table: This innovative table can be folded down when not in use, saving valuable floor space. When unfolded, it becomes a functional dining area for family meals or entertaining guests. Additionally, it often comes with built-in shelving or drawers, offering extra storage options.

  3. Ottoman with hidden storage: A stylish ottoman not only provides a comfortable footrest but also acts as a secret storage unit. Lift the top to reveal a spacious compartment, ideal for stashing away books, blankets, or other items that need a designated place.

With these space-saving furniture ideas, you can create a harmonious and organized living space in your barn conversion, fostering a sense of belonging and comfort.

Utilizing Vertical Space

Utilizing vertical space in barn conversions requires strategic planning and innovative design solutions. Here are three space-saving hacks that will help you make the most of your vertical space:

  1. Lofted beds: By elevating your beds, you can create additional storage or living space beneath. This clever solution not only maximizes the use of vertical space but also adds a cozy and intimate feel to your barn conversion.

  2. Vertical gardening: Transform your barn into a lush green oasis with vertical gardens. Install wall-mounted planters or utilize hanging baskets to bring nature indoors. Not only will this make your space more aesthetically pleasing, but it will also improve air quality and create a peaceful atmosphere.

  3. Built-in shelving: Incorporate built-in shelves along your walls to optimize storage space. This will help you keep your belongings organized and easily accessible, while also adding a touch of rustic charm to your barn conversion.

Light and Color Strategies

In our barn conversion projects, we employ effective light and color strategies to enhance the sense of space and create a welcoming atmosphere. By harnessing the power of natural lighting, we bring warmth and brightness into the converted space. Large windows allow sunlight to flood the room, making it feel open and inviting. Additionally, we carefully consider color psychology when choosing paint colors and furnishings. Soft and neutral tones create a sense of tranquility and balance, while pops of vibrant colors add energy and personality. Through our thoughtful use of light and color, we aim to create a space that embraces and nurtures a sense of belonging, making it a place where people can truly feel at home.
